Monday, April 29, 2024 - Bare sap attenuation impels tea and raspberries, weeping fluently with stone. Engaging complexity, bitter gravel roots, flushing action. After flirting with interesting leafy stem resin, It resolves in haste. Quite dry. Overbrewed iced tea tannin. 24 hours later, straight from the fridge, of course it tastes just as good, but now I notice how this amounts to a flavor-attenuated version of Luyt's red cru Pipeños—modulated, drier, a bit more carelessly drinkable.

Purchased from new inventory within the last few months—I suspect it's based in 2022 fruit, though I find no serial markings on the glass, labels, nor closure.
